#478fcc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#478fcc is composed of 27.8% red, 56.1%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.2% cyan, 29.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 207.5 degrees, a saturation of 56.6% and a lightness of 53.9%. #478fcc color hex could be obtained by blending #8effff with #001f99.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

#478fcc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#478fcc has RGB values of R:71, G:143, B:204 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0.3,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 4689868.
